Sheba's Breast Cancer Radiation Therapy Unit ranks among the world's most advanced. Our team excels in the use of cutting-edge technologies that ensure safe treatment that protects vital organs. Techniques include radiation therapy with breath holding, pressurised air masks, and intraoperative radiation therapy for the breast, among others.
At Sheba, we offer advanced radiation protocols, allowing us to provide a variety of radiation treatments, including a one-off intraoperative option. Each treatment is tailor-made to fit the unique body structure of the patient, the stage of their disease, the risk of the disease coming back, and the potential for complications and side effects.
Follow-up for our patients involves personal support and care throughout and after their radiation treatment. As part of this process, we help manage side effects, offer guidance for ongoing check-ups, and provide opportunities to participate in clinical studies.
The team at Sheba is dedicated to enhancing radiation outcomes for women post-breast reconstruction and takes part in international studies.
The Breast Cancer Radiation Therapy Unit is a key part of the multidisciplinary program for the diagnosis and treatment of breast cancer at Sheba. Our team participates in meetings and case discussions of patients with breast cancer to formulate an optimal treatment plan.
Patient Guidance Program
The Radiation Institute's team conducts group sessions aimed at preparing individuals for their breast radiation treatments, helping patients arrive better prepared and more at ease. These sessions, led by a nurse, a dietician, and a social worker, happen every two weeks. Information about the sessions is provided to every new patient upon admission to the institute, on the day of the simulation, and on the institute's notice boards.
What can you expect from the guidance session? You'll get an introduction to the Radiation Institute and the team you'll be working with. We'll walk you through the radiation planning process, acquaint you with the radiation rooms, and introduce you to the equipment we use. Plus, we'll talk about the common side effects of breast radiation and share some tips on how to prevent and deal with them.
We recommend attending the session near the start of your treatments. Don't hesitate to ask the secretariat if you need to sign up for the training in advance.
